Job Title: Business Intelligence Developer

Job Responsibilities:

Development

- Develop expertise in all law firm application SQL table structures and relationships, becoming an expert in data analysis and addressing data integrity and reconciliation issues.
- Develop specifications for enhancements, customizations, and integrations as requested by management and business groups.
- Gain familiarity with various development tools utilized by the law firm.
- Execute customizations and integrations, performing quality assurance and regression testing of all modifications to law firm applications in test and production environments.
- Maintain detailed records and document procedures, assumptions, workflows, methodologies, and information sources used during analytical tasks.
- Demonstrate strong TSQL development skills, including writing stored procedures, triggers, data modeling, and ETL.
- Possess strong hands-on experience using Microsoft SQL Server 2016 or greater suite of development tools, including SSRS, SSAS, SSIS, and SSIS Catalog.
- Understand SQL Server security and management tools.
- Manage full life cycle development, including design, development, implementation, documentation, training, and on-going support for enterprise-level applications.
- Use integrated development environments and version control systems such as Visual Studio and SQL Server Management Studio.

Support/Maintenance

- Develop expertise in law firm integration tools, design integration logic, and provide second-level support to resolve issues with integrations.
- Conduct day-to-day support and technical administration of systems, reports, integrations, and associated modules.
- Monitor the performance of integration and automation, taking corrective action to identify opportunities to optimize and improve system performance.
- Escalate unresolved problems to the infrastructure and management team and promptly communicate with affected users.

Project Management

- Participate and contribute to internal and external/vendor project teams for initiatives at various levels.
- Assume project management responsibilities for selected projects.
- Review specifications for completeness and accuracy.
- Create, track, and update all project tasks, continually informing the department and management of the project's status.
- Work with management and users to evaluate and clarify requests.
- Perform ongoing analysis of departmental development needs and make recommendations for the efficient use of law firm applications.
- Perform other duties as assigned.

Education and Experience:

- 5 years of experience working and supporting SQL applications in an IT environment.
- A 4-year degree in an IT-related field is highly preferred.
- 3-5 years of experience developing reports using SSRS.
- 3-5 years of experience using ETL tools such as SSIS.
- 3-5 years of experience using visual analytical tools such as Power BI.

Salary Information:

The annualized salary range for this position is $105,000 to $115,000. Actual pay may be adjusted based on experience and other job-related factors permitted by law. This position also offers bonuses and a full benefits package. The benefits package includes, but is not limited to, health insurance, dental insurance, life insurance, a 401(k) plan, flexible spending, and more.
